Nigerian Meteorological Agency (NiMet) predicts early onset of rainfall.

The Nigerian Meteorological Agency (NiMet) has predicted early onset rainfall and early cessation in many parts of the country, especially the northern part.
The Director-General, NiMet, Prof. Sani Machi, who revealed this during the public presentation of the agency’s 2017 Seasonal rainfall Prediction yesterday in Abuja added that the onset date of the growing season was predicted to run from the 25th of February over the coastal states to the 16th of June in the far north.
Prof. Machi, stressed that onset was also predicted to be normal in many areas, explaining that it would be early in parts of the northwest, the eastern flank of Adamawa and Taraba as well as the coastal states.
He added that cessation dates of the rains in 2017 are predicted to start from the 4th of October in the extreme north and reach the coastal states around 25th of December.
